由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Programming版 - 求助,C++调用C 函数 的 LNK 2019 Error
相关主题
相关话题的讨论汇总
话题: main话题: mesh话题: error话题: lnk话题: mesh2d
进入Programming版参与讨论
1 (共1页)
W*W
发帖数: 293
1
用c++调用c 生成的library 出现 LNK 2019 Error。
#include
...
extern int mesh_main(const char*);
int main()
{
...
mesh_main(file.c_str());
}
mesh_main 是 mesh2d_main 里面定义的函数。
X****r
发帖数: 3557
2
extern "C" {
// You don't want to include the C source file.
// Just include its header and link with its
// compiled objective file or library.
#include
}
int main() {
...
mesh_main(file.c_str());
}

【在 W*W 的大作中提到】
: 用c++调用c 生成的library 出现 LNK 2019 Error。
: #include
: ...
: extern int mesh_main(const char*);
: int main()
: {
: ...
: mesh_main(file.c_str());
: }
: mesh_main 是 mesh2d_main 里面定义的函数。

W*W
发帖数: 293
3
thanks a lot, problem solved with your answer !!
1 (共1页)
进入Programming版参与讨论
相关主题
相关话题的讨论汇总
话题: main话题: mesh话题: error话题: lnk话题: mesh2d